Hotel Taimar, Costa Calma. We went All Inclusive with Jet2 for 14 nights. 2 adults. Exceptionally clean and modern after a major refurb in 2020. Double room, very spacious with balcony on the 1st floor. No sea view as nowhere near the sea. Shower was amazing and beds incredibly comfortable. Large wardrobe, 4 hangers, shelves and a safe (€30) 15-20 minute walk into Costa Calma town centre (not very much going on in way of shops, bars and restaurants). Beach absolutely stunning which makes up for the town’s shortcomings. This hotel should be advertised as Adults Only, as there is absolutely nothing for children to do there nor catered for. The swimming pool is small and pool toys such as inflatables are not allowed. This hotel should not be advertised as All Inclusive. Although drinks are served at the pool bar from 11.00-6.00, there are NO snacks through the day at all, only that morning’s left over pastries from breakfast are put on the bar around 4.30pm, that is the only food served between meals and only from that bar. You are served drinks by the staff in the restaurant at lunch and dinner, you don’t help yourself like in most All Inclusive hotels. You are NOT allowed to fill water battles from the water machines, if you arrive at night you may have a cup of water each from the water machine in reception, while eating the meal provided for you, other wise there are 2 x 500ml welcome bottles of water in your room. We sat in a dark restaurant at midnight when we arrived. There is nowhere to enjoy drinks in the evenings after dinner as there isn’t a lounge area, just 3 tables with bar stools in the windiest area of the restaurant. The whole restaurant is windy, ridiculously so at times and chilly with it, so take a hoodie or lil jacket. The patio heaters were removed for our last night, we think to discourage anyone staying later than 11pm when the bar closes….on the dot, lights off. There is NO evening entertainment at all. Food was nice, local, had a vegetarian and a pasta option, meat, fish and chips, but a small selection. Not very much going on with desserts though….to my husband’s dismay. The majority of the bar & waiting on staff were efficient and friendly, the kitchen staff were ok if you spoke to them, otherwise silent. I stayed here on a solo break for 7 nights and I'm currently writing this from the pool bar as I await my transfer pick up. When I arrived a week ago, it was very late and I was greeted by a very polite gentleman at reception. The hotel had plated some cold food (which was delicious - chicken, salad, fruit and the like) as it was after the restaurant had closed. After a long day with flight delays, this was a lovely touch. He explained very clearly the opening times for everything, and pointed out where my room was with no issue. The food each day has been lovely, there wasn't huge variety but that meant what was there was well thought out and cooked beautifully. Whenever something was starting to empty from the buffet, it was replaced promptly with a fresh batch. The bar staff both in the restaurant and poolside were always polite, friendly and attentive. The only time my room wasn't cleaned was when I placed my 'Do Not Distrub' sign on the door. Every other day, I found my room to be clean, towels replaced, and bed made. The room itself, just like the rest of the hotel, was modern and clean. I loved the entire design of the hotel, it's just what's needed for a relaxing break away. The only downside I would say it that the water refill stations state not to fill bottles up - it's not the end of the world as there's no limit to the amount you can get up for a glass of water, but as someone who drinks at least 2L per day, I'd have liked to have filled a bottle up. Costa Calma itself is very quiet, the walk to the beach is lovely and there are lots of lovely running routes in the area. Despite it being remote, I didn't at any point feel unsafe, and it was a perfect break away. If you're wanting something lively and to get hammered every night, then I'd stay elsewhere, however, that isn't everyone's cup of tea. Hotel Taimar was exactly my cup of tea.
